Seek out that particular mental attribute which makes you feel most deeply and vitally alive, along with which comes the inner voice which says, 'This is the real me,' and when you have found that attitude, follow it.

- James Truslow Adams

This quote emphasizes the importance of self-discovery and authenticity. It encourages the reader to identify what makes them feel most alive and to follow that inner voice, which is often the most genuine and true representation of oneself. The quote suggests that when we are true to ourselves, we are more likely to find happiness and fulfillment.

The quote is urging the reader to find their own unique sense of purpose and authenticity, rather than trying to conform to societal expectations or norms. It's a call to self-reflection and introspection, encouraging the reader to explore their own values, passions, and desires.
